On September 30, 2020, Robert Tepper, M.D. notified the Allena Pharmaceuticals, Inc. of his intent to resign from the Board of Directors and from his position as member of the Nominating and Corporate Governance Committee of the Board, effective as of October 5, 2020. Dr. Tepper's decision to not stand for reelection was not related to any disagreement with the Company on any matter relating to its operations, policies, practices or any issues regarding financial disclosures, accounting or legal matters. On October 5, 2020, the Board appointed Ann C. Miller, M.D. to the Board, effective October 5, 2020. Dr. Miller will serve as a Class III director with a term expiring at the Company's next annual meeting of stockholders, which is expected to be held on November 17, 2020 (the Annual Meeting), and until such time as her successor is duly elected and qualified, or until her earlier death, resignation or removal. Further, effective immediately following the Annual Meeting, the Board appointed Dr. Miller to serve on the audit and compensation committees of the Board, subject to her election as a director by the Company's stockholders at the Annual Meeting. Following the appointment of Dr. Miller, the Company's Class III directors consist of Robert Alexander, Ph.D., Ann C. Miller, M.D. and Gino Santini. The terms for the Company's Class III directors will expire at the Annual Meeting. Dr. Miller has launched and grown multiple blockbuster products and built leading franchises over the course of her career. Most recently, she spent six years at Sanofi, ultimately serving as Vice President, Marketing, where she was selected to lead a corporate-wide initiative on Marketing Excellence.
